CAD 1039 - SolidWorks

Institution:
Rochester Community and Technical College
Subject:
Description:
This course offers students the understanding of 3D parametric solid modeling using SolidWorks. It also addresses the concepts of parametric design, design intent, and the necessary commands to carry out these functions. Items covered will be construction of 3D solid modeling parts, assemblies, and creating 2D automated drawings. Learning by example: students will design real world products with SolidWorks. This course will be taught using the latest release of SolidWorks. Students must receive a grade of C or better in all CAD courses. (Prerequisites: None. Other requirements: RCTC CAD Major.)
